Education and Training

A boiler engineer oversees, operates, and keeps temperature and ventilation systems in large centers and plants. This is a demanding task that requires training and a high level of proficiency to keep up with evolving innovations and market guidelines. Normally, a bachelor's degree and expert accreditations are required to end up being a boiler engineer. Nevertheless, numerous people with non-engineering backgrounds can still become qualified through training and experience.

An everyday routine for a boiler engineer consists of ensuring the systems work effectively. This includes changing temperature levels, ensuring gas pressure is appropriate, and cleansing devices. This can likewise include fixing broken equipment and recognizing prospective safety dangers. They must have strong analytical skills to assess complex circumstances and make informed decisions rapidly.


Boiler engineers frequently collaborate with other professionals to maintain and repair devices. This requires excellent interaction abilities to efficiently communicate technical details plainly and precisely. They are also responsible for establishing and preserving safety procedures, so they should have the ability to follow these standards at all times.

While carrying out upkeep tasks, a boiler engineer need to have the ability to determine and fix issues quickly and effectively. This is particularly crucial when it comes to resolving problems that could be possibly harmful for others operating in the location. This might include a leaking pipe or malfunctioning control.

Boiler engineers must be able to understand and interpret technical data and documents. This can consist of checking out plans, interpreting electrical data, and understanding mechanical specs. They need to also be able to use computer software application to monitor devices, records, and examinations. In addition, they require to remain up-to-date on market standards and regulations by going to workshops or workshops.

Safety

Boiler Engineers often face possible physical dangers in the course of their work. They should follow strict safety guidelines to avoid accidents and keep their equipment running effectively. This may include using proper personal protective equipment or examining risks before starting jobs. They also make sure that all safety features in their systems are working properly.

Boilers are utilized to heat big centers and power commercial equipment. They can be discovered in a variety of shapes and sizes, but all boilers run under similar conditions. An excellent boiler engineer in Buckingham will have substantial knowledge of how these machines work and how they can be fixed or kept. They will be able to recognize common problems and recommend options to repair them.

The most common issues associated with boilers are leaking and dripping water, loss of pressure, and thermostat issues. The primary step in attending to these issues is to figure out the source of the problem. For example, if the boiler is dripping water it might be due to a leak in the system or a faulty valve. If the boiler is losing pressure it might be due to the fact that of an obstruction in the system or a concern with the thermostat.

Given that boiler systems are intricate, it is essential for a boiler engineer to have strong analytical skills. This consists of being able to identify and translate readings, along with repair any breakdowns or mistakes that might take place in the system. It is also essential for them to be able to communicate technical details plainly so that others can comprehend it. This ability is specifically helpful when communicating with other professionals, like maintenance technicians and safety inspectors.
